Read Online Reforming Senates: Upper Legislative Houses in North Atlantic Small Powers 1800-present (Routledge Studies in Modern History) Hardcover
Add Comment
Reforming Senates: Upper Legislative Houses in North Atlantic Small Powers 1800-present (Routledge Studies in Modern History)
Edit
Download Reforming Senates: Upper Legislative Houses in North Atlantic Small Powers 1800-present (Routledge Studies in Modern History) PDF ...
Read More